Meeting and Pickup Details

Getting ready for the Colosseum guided tour starts with knowing where to meet.

Travelers should head to La Vineria di Angelino in Monti, Rome. A friendly staff member will greet them at the Angelino ai Fori Restaurant, holding a Viator sign for easy identification.

Arriving early is a smart move, ensuring everyone has time to settle in and ask questions. The tour wraps up back at the same spot, making it convenient for participants to explore the area afterward.

Booking and Cancellation Policies

When planning a visit to the Colosseum and Ancient Rome guided tour, it’s crucial to understand the booking and cancellation policies to avoid any surprises.

Travelers can enjoy instant booking confirmation online, but they should note that all tickets are non-refundable. Each ticket costs €18, with an additional €2 reservation fee per person.

Since cancellations don’t lead to refunds, it’s wise to be certain about your plans before booking. Also, check for any specific requirements, such as valid ID for entry, to ensure a smooth experience.
